How they compare
Greece currently reports 419,814 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re against 406,670 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re in Romania, a difference of 13,144 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 47 shared years of data; in 1976 it was Romania ahead.
Greece ranks 53rd and Romania ranks 55th of 198 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Greece averaged higher in 3 and Romania in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Greece | Romania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 23,018 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 32,906 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 9,888 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Romania |
| 1980s | 37,756 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 48,389 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 10,633 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Romania |
| 1990s | 47,987 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 28,137 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 19,850 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Greece |
| 2000s | 131,667 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 91,307 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 40,360 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Greece |
| 2010s | 238,988 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 257,029 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 18,040 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Romania |
| 2020s | 370,597 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 361,742 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| 8,854 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re | Greece |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Goods exports (BoP, current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
